What Happens to an Inmate's Money When They're Released from Lancaster County Prison

Remaining account funds don't vanish when someone leaves Lancaster County Prison. Instead, they're issued a debit card loaded with whatever balance remains. No cash - just a card they can use right away.

Transfers work differently. If someone moves from Lancaster County Prison to another facility, the prison sends a check for the remaining balance directly to the receiving institution. The money follows them through the system, but it goes institution-to-institution - not into their hands on the way out.

Account setup happens immediately. When someone is committed to Lancaster County Prison, an account is created using a contracted system that provides real-time updates. Any money found on them at intake goes straight into that account.

Formal oversight backs every balance. The Director of Administration manages inmate financial accounts, while the Lancaster County Controller oversees related funds and conducts annual audits. If you ever have questions about a balance or disbursement, know there's a defined structure and audit process in place.
